Damage will depend on how hard the engine was going at the time of the break.
Generally damage will be limited push rods or rockers but at the other end of the scale valves through pistions etc are not unheard of. Tappet cover off and strip out front will assess amount of damage.

6g72 12 valve motor is a free spinner so you should be right. :)

The 6g74 DOHC is an interferance one.

Standard 2.5 repair is rocker arms. They crack the housings that hold the rocker arm in place but usually saves the valves.
